Home & Garden Expo Aims to Ease Covenant Process

Flowers at RA Community Garden Lake AnneAspiring gardeners, interior designers and home-improvers of all sorts can head to the Reston Home & Garden Expo on Saturday.

Free to Reston residents, the event will be held in the Reston Association’s conference center from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m.

The expo set to be held for the fifth time will include three workshops and more than 20 exhibitions by companies that specialize in design, paving, lighting and more.

The focus of the event will be on how residents can seamlessly work within Reston’s covenant design review rules, RA communications and community engagement director Kirsten Carr said Friday.

“As you’re talking with people who can do your windows and do your remodeling, we’ll have covenant staff who can go through the whole process with you,” she said. “It will be one-stop shopping.”

The following workshops will be offered.

Let Covenants Work for You, 10:30 to 11:15 a.m.
Presenter: Reston Association covenants staff

How to Qualify a Contractor, 11:30 a.m. to 12:15 p.m.
Presenter: Mark Fies, Synergy Design & Construction

Color Trends in Interior Design, 12:30-1:15 p.m.
Presenter: Amelia Vallone, Amelia Vallone Interiors

 The Reston Home & Garden Expo will take place at 12001 Sunrise Valley Dr.
